Economies of Scale

The cost advantages that enterpises obtain due to their scale of operation, with cost per unit of output generally decreasing with increasing scale.

Learning-by-doing

Learning-by-doing is the process of improving skills and efficiency in a task or operation through practical experience and repetition over time.

Labor Specialization

The division of labor where individuals focus on a narrow area of expertise, improving efficiency and productivity.
